Abstract

The invention discloses a method for transmitting data between mobile communication terminals using a mobile application program. The method comprises: a step 1 of selecting data needed to be transmitted to another mobile communication terminal in a momobile communication terminal; a step 2 of transmitting the selected data on a transmitting mobile communication terminal; a step 3 of receiving the data by a receiving mobile communication terminal, the steps are realized by the mobile application program. The invention transmits data to other mobile communication terminals by using the mobile application program, communication means such as bluetooth and the like in the mobile communication terminals, when data is transmitted between the mobile communication terminals, direct transmission can be performed without server of mobile comminication operator or personal computer so as to reduce expense without limitation of location. Meanwhile, the data transmission according to the invention is realized by the mobile application program, thereby received data can be performed various processing by data processing operation.

Below, the Bluetooth technology that is suitable among the desirable embodiment of the present invention is elaborated.
((Bluetooth) technology is applied in mobile communication terminal, computer, computer peripheral devices, the individual palmtop PC PDA devices such as (Personal Digital Assistant) bluetooth, realize the mutual wireless connections in the short range, it is technology based on data communication, in the place that family, company or public place etc. are restricted, can realize wireless connections with phone, PC PC etc.
The device that is suitable for above-mentioned bluetooth generally uses the frequency band of 2.45GHz, comprises data channel and maximum 3 voice-grade channels, and according to the IEEE802 standard, address (address) accounts for 48 bits (bit), can carry out point-to-point and the multiple spot connection.
Current, the wireless connections service range that above-mentioned Bluetooth technology realized is between 10 meters to 1 kilometer, and transfer of data is between 1Mbps to 2Mbps.Along with the development of technology, its application and the scope of application are also enlarging.
Carry out Bluetooth communication, at first should in a blue-tooth device, retrieve and land other blue-tooth device.Each blue-tooth device all has its intrinsic address, so need retrieval and land this inherent address.
Here, the blue-tooth device that requires to connect is main blue-tooth device, and connected blue-tooth device is from blue-tooth device.
If a blue-tooth device wishes to be connected with other blue-tooth device, the main blue-tooth device (master) that requires to connect need be known as the address from blue-tooth device (slave) that is connected object, sends page information.If do not know corresponding address, send page information after, send inquiry Inquiry information.That receives inquiry message sends oneself address from blue-tooth device to main blue-tooth device.
